在海洋水文研究中,绘图是不可或缺的工具。MATLAB作为一款功能强大、易于使用的科学计算软件,被广泛应用于海洋领域。在进行海洋水文实践时,我们经常需要对数据进行可视化,以便更好地理解和分析数据。而设置合适的绘图标题,可以提供关键信息并凸显图像主题,从而使数据更加直观且易于理解。
5 F5 Z3 r1 I1 w$ X, F& N/ s- I2 S0 \
首先,我们需要了解如何使用MATLAB设置绘图标题。在MATLAB中,设置绘图标题非常简单。可以通过使用title函数来实现。该函数的基本语法为:title('标题内容')。其中,标题内容可以是字符串,也可以是变量名。
. e: g/ S1 U! z1 m- `3 y0 t
! U' ~' K' Q0 u在设置绘图标题时,我们需要考虑几个关键因素。首先是标题的清晰度。我们需要确保标题简明扼要,并能准确传达图像的主要信息。其次是字体的大小和样式。通常情况下,标题的字体大小应与其他标签相匹配,以确保整体风格统一。此外,可以根据需要选择合适的字体样式,如粗体或斜体,以突出重点或增加艺术感。最后是标题的位置。标题的位置应该使其与图像的主要元素相对应,既不会遮挡重要信息,也不会显得过于拥挤。
/ w9 _/ W( I* `4 w& c* Z. E8 @1 D3 ~. K, i0 N- Y0 S
在海洋水文实践中,我们可以通过MATLAB绘制各种图形来展示和分析数据。例如,我们可以使用plot函数绘制时间序列图,以显示海洋温度随时间的变化趋势。在设置标题时,可以使用如下代码:
" \# c& X2 R' L5 a# A) S' F2 N% N' K
```matlab
. [2 \0 e0 W& g; F: Wx = 1:10;& C' t6 ? d$ [' s
y = [23.5 24.2 24.8 25.3 25.6 25.1 24.7 24.3 23.9 23.5];
/ n2 @) J/ y4 l; h9 L' L Y; O6 Y1 p6 D5 H' g
plot(x, y);
0 {/ f! D. D7 Z# p7 H. n F7 ititle('海洋温度变化趋势');. `' k* b/ i% }1 Q* _, Z8 c( y
```7 U/ [, p! {. b5 T1 ]
, M3 D8 T! l: h
上述代码中,我们创建了一个简单的时间序列图,并使用title函数设置了图像的标题为“海洋温度变化趋势”。
/ k) J1 i3 J. h8 a. A1 v& [, a3 v8 ^7 o
除了时间序列图,我们还可以使用其他类型的图形来展示海洋水文数据。例如,我们可以使用scatter函数绘制散点图,以显示不同位置的海洋流速和风速之间的关系。在设置标题时,可以使用如下代码:; g8 h% T) K- D* k- `
! n' `. y. `- G# H4 ]; P ]```matlab
0 S5 P3 `0 E; jx = [2.3 4.5 1.2 3.8 5.1];
. G) w& X, h$ U! yy = [3.2 5.1 2.6 4.9 5.8];9 W8 X/ e! ?' i( W
u = [0.8 1.2 0.9 1.5 1.8];
/ B0 ?! Q2 M& G8 k4 L5 z1 Sv = [0.6 1.1 0.5 1.4 1.6];
, a8 l% G' O' E) W
# v9 D y; |: k! k2 \- a9 Pscatter(x, y, 50, hypot(u, v), 'filled');
3 i2 Q8 k2 c/ W. L/ _title('海洋流速和风速关系图');
0 N, S' ~0 E5 V1 p7 S/ I% r6 Q5 d [' u```
% S* h- q% p1 ~. w$ i8 U! C0 U, W2 u) D$ G9 a
在上述代码中,我们使用scatter函数绘制了一个散点图,并使用title函数设置了图像的标题为“海洋流速和风速关系图”。
# l* H7 |. p/ I' ~% Z7 m# w1 t) X% F: h- F: y3 ^; r
总之,绘图标题是展示和分析海洋水文数据时的重要元素。通过合理设置绘图标题,可以提供关键信息并突出图像主题。MATLAB作为一款强大而易用的科学计算软件,提供了简便的方法来设置绘图标题。在海洋水文实践中,我们可以利用MATLAB的绘图功能将数据可视化,从而更好地理解和分析海洋水文现象。 |